Jul 10, 1991 · Powered by JustWatch. Mike Nichols ' "Regarding Henry" opens with a portrait of a Manhattan lawyer as a driven, ambitious man who lives in great wealth and little happiness. Then a catastrophe occurs. He steps out one night to buy some cigarettes, and is shot in a holdup.

Regarding Henry is a 1991 American drama film directed by Mike Nichols and written by J.J. Abrams. It stars Harrison Ford as a New York City lawyer from a dysfunctional family , who struggles to regain his memory and recover his speech and mobility after he survives a shooting, inadvertently restoring his family's integrity in the process.

Henry Turner is a high-class, successful lawyer whose family life is in shambles; he is cold and distant from both his wife and daughter, and focuses mainly on his work. One night, Henry stops by a convenience store to buy cigarettes and is shot during a robbery. When he revives he is a timid shadow of his former self and afflicted with amnesia.
